Helen Belcher Obituary

Helen Roope Belcher, 76, of Dublin, Va., passed away on Thursday evening, November 12, 2009, at the Pulaski Health & Rehab Center. Born on April 1, 1933, in Dublin, she was the daughter of the late Roy and Cecilia Harmon Roope. Her daughter, Linda Sue East Shouse; and brother, Roy H. Roope; also preceded her in death. She worked at the Highland Manor Nursing home as a dietarian technician for 20 years. She is survived by her husband , Mack Belcher, of Dublin; son and daughterin-law, John and Connie East, of Dublin; four grandchildren; eight great-grandchildren; brothers and sisters-in-law, Randall and Sue Roope, of Dublin, and Steve "Mac" and Betty Roope, of Dublin; sister and brother-in-law, Carolyn Roope Eadie and husband, Kelly, of Chapin, S.C.; and sister-in-law , Alice Roope, of Dublin. Funeral services will be held 2 p.m. on Sunday, November 15, 2009, at the Bower Funeral Home Chapel, Pulaski with the Rev. Michael Collins officiating. Interment will follow at the Old Dublin Cemetery. The family will receive friends from 5 to 7 p.m. on Saturday evening, November 14, 2009, at the Bower Funeral Home, Pulaski.
